Best IAS Coaching in India for Civil Services Aspirants


The Civil Services Examination is one of the most respected and challenging exams in the country. With vast syllabi covering history, geography, economics, ethics, polity, environment, and current affairs, aspirants often seek professional guidance from the leading UPSC institute in India. These institutes are known for their structured teaching plans, qualified teachers, and systematic evaluation processes.

Students preparing for the civil services require more than academic knowledge; they need critical thinking ability, writing clarity, and an awareness of global and domestic issues. The top coaching institutes provide regular tests, answer writing practice, interview training, and subject-wise mentorship. Many offer all-in-one programmes covering prelims, main examination, and interview preparation to ensure complete support throughout the journey.

Coaching Institutes with Fees: Assessing Costs and Benefits


One of the major considerations for students and parents is analysing the fee structure of different coaching institutes. Fees vary depending on the type of course, duration, faculty expertise, study resources offered, and additional facilities such as test series and workshops. Institutes offering comprehensive year-long programmes for exams like CLAT or civil services often have premium pricing due to the level of support and time commitment involved.

When comparing institutes by cost, it is essential to evaluate whether the services offered offer true value. A premium price does not always guarantee superior outcomes, and a lower fee does not necessarily indicate lesser quality. Students should examine teaching quality, class size, performance reports, and feedback systems to determine overall value. Transparent fee structures and honest information about study materials, offline or online access, and additional charges help students make informed decisions.
